In the last few years there has been an increasing incidence of infection due to non-neoformans Cryptococcus spp. especially in immunocompromised host. Cryptococcus laurentii is a non-neoformans Cryptococcus which has rarely been known to cause bacteremia and pulmonary infection in humans. Here we report a case of fungemia due to Cryptococcus laurentii.

OBJECTIVE: Assessment of the growth and nutritional status among healthy Bengali adolescent schoolgirls at peri-urban area. METHODS: In this cross sectional study, sample consists of 527 school going adolescent girls, aged 10 to 18 years. The sample of the present study was collected from a peri-urban area (Duttapukur) of north 24 parganas district of West Bengal, India. Standard anthropometric measurements including linear, curvilinear and skinfold thickness were collected from each subject. Percentile curves and nutritional indices were used to determine the growth and nutritional status respectively. RESULTS: The nature of distance curves and percentile curves of the body measurements showed a high rate of increase in 10-11 years of age group corresponding to an earlier adolescent growth spurt than average Indian girls. The adolescent girls in the current study were found to be significantly (p<0.0001) taller than Indian girls and heavier than both Indian and urban Bengali girls but slightly shorter than urban Bengali girls. They are significantly (p<0.0001) shorter and lighter than American girls, which also corresponded to 50(th) percentile curves. Age specific nutritional assessment shows different grades of malnutrition among them. Gomez's classification indicates about 60 % to 70 % adolescent girls show either moderate to mild malnutrition during their growth period. Both the indices of Waterlow's classification show least percentage of least malnutrition among the girls. CONCLUSION: The growth pattern and nutritional status observed among adolescent girls in peri-urban situation show heterogeneity with respect to some anthropometric traits and in conformity with the growth pattern and nutritional status of urban girls.

BACKGROUND & OBJECTIVES: Several physiological changes affecting physical fitness occur in humans whenever they are exposed to extremes of environments such as heat, cold and high altitude (HA). The present study was undertaken to evaluate effect of stay in desert and HA on physical fitness and body composition of physically active individuals. METHODS: Study was conducted on three groups of male soldiers (n=30 in each group) at different climatic conditions i.e., temperate (plains of north India), hot desert (Rajasthan), and HA (3600 m) in Western Himalayas. Subjects were acclimatized to hot and HA environments and had similar BMI (body mass index). Body fat, lean body mass, haemoglobin levels were determined along with, blood pressure and physical fitness index (PFI). RESULTS: The body fat of subjects at temperate, desert and HA was found to be 15.4, 12.8 and 16.9 per cent respectively. The resting heart rate and blood pressure were higher in altitude group in comparison to others. PFI score of volunteers at temperate, desert and HA were found to be 97.4 +/- 10.3, 92.4+/- 14.4 and 83.8 +/- 6.2 respectively. INTERPRETATION & CONCLUSION: A combination of different factors i.e., higher resting pulse rate, increased blood pressure and body fat may be responsible for lower PFI at HA. The observed differences in body fat content of different groups could be an adaptive feature to the environment.

We conducted this study to explore the socioeconomic conditions, and health and nutritional status of whole time child domestic labor. 330 children engaged in domestic child labor ranging between 8 to 14 years of age from the metropolitan city of Kolkata were studied. Majority of the domestic child laborers were girls and migrants coming from illiterate families. These children were physically, mentally or sexually abused. Further, they suffered from anemia, gastrointestinal tract infections, vitamin deficiencies, respiratory tract infections and skin diseases along with a high prevalence of malnutrition. The study highlights the poor state of domestic child labor in Kolkata, India.

Ascent to extreme High Altitude (HA) is in steps and it entails acclimatization at moderately HA locations. In terms of acclimatization, it is pertinent to understand the physiological changes, which occur on immediate ascent to moderate HA. The study aimed to evaluate the effect of ascent to 3500 m on neuro-endocrine responses in the first hour of induction. The plasma levels of catecholamines and cortisol were measured before and after one hour of ascent to high altitude. The peripheral oxygen saturation (SpO2), Galvanic Skin Resistance (GSR), Heart Rate (HR) and Blood Pressure (BP) were simultaneously monitored. The plasma epinephrine, norepinephrine, dopamine and cortisol were increased after one-hour exposure to 3500 m altitude as compared to before exposure. The SpO2 showed a significant decrease during and after high altitude induction. The heart rate and diastolic BP increased at 3500 m whereas the GSR did not show significant changes. There are changes in neuroendocrine responses, which reflect a sympathetic over activity in the first hour of exposure to 3500 m.

The effect of hypobaric hypoxia on visual evoked potential (VEP) was studied in 27 male volunteers at sea level (SL), during the 1st and 3rd weeks of their stay at high altitude (HA) of 3,500 m and in the 1st week of their return to the sea level (RSL). Exposure to high altitude (HA) led to significant changes in VEP. The N1 wave latency of both right and left eye was significantly increased (P<0.05) during 3rd week of stay at the altitude which persisted even after the return to the sea level. The latency of P1 wave of both right and left eye was higher in 3rd week at high altitude but not significant statistically. But the delay in P1 latency persisted in 1st week of their return to sea level which was significant (p<0.05) statistically as compared to sea level. The latency of N2 wave was significantly decreased (P<0.05) during the 1st week of stay at HA and returned back to basal value in the 3rd week of stay at HA in both right and left eye. However, the changes observed in NPN complex in terms of wave latencies were within the physiological limits. The amplitude of wave N1-P1 of both the right and left eye did not show any change. The changes observed reflect the process of acclimatisation to 3500m high altitude.

BACKGROUND & OBJECTIVES: Induction to high altitude leads to altered central nervous system (CNS) functions induced by hypobaric hypoxia. The sensory systems like visual and auditory systems are reported to be affected by hypoxia. The present study was undertaken to assess the effects of hypobaric hypoxia on visual evoked potentials (VEPs) at 3200 m and 4300 m. METHODS: The VEP of 30 human volunteers were recorded at sea level (SL) and then at high altitude (HA) of 3200 m (HA I) and 4300 m (HA II) in eastern Himalayas and on return to sea level (RSL). The absolute latencies and amplitude of positive and negative waves were recorded. RESULTS: High altitude of 3200 m did not alter the latency of major wave N1, P1 and N2 of the VEPs. At HA II (4300 m), there was a statistically significant increase (P < 0.01) in the latency of NI wave as compared to the SL value and HA I (3200 m) in both left and right eye. There was a slight increase in latenty of P1 wave in both left and right eye at HA II. INTERPRETATION & CONCLUSION: From these results it may be concluded that induction to HA causes increase in latency of N1 wave at 4300 m which is still within physiological limits. This increase in wave latency of N1 wave in both eyes may be due to synaptic delay and/or altered neuronal processing at HA.

The continuous exposure to the relatively high level of noise in the surroundings of an airport is likely to affect the central pathway of the auditory system as well as the cognitive functions of the people working in that environment. The Brainstem Auditory Evoked Responses (BAER), Mid Latency Response (MLR) and P300 response of the ground crew employees working in Mumbai airport were studied to evaluate the effects of continuous exposure to high level of noise of the surroundings of the airport on these responses. BAER, P300 and MLR were recorded by using a Nicolet Compact-4 (USA) instrument. Audiometry was also monitored with the help of GSI-16 Audiometer. There was a significant increase in the peak III latency of the BAER in the subjects exposed to noise compared to controls with no change in their P300 values. The exposed group showed hearing loss at different frequencies. The exposure to the high level of noise caused a considerable decline in the auditory conduction upto the level of the brainstem with no significant change in conduction in the midbrain, subcortical areas, auditory cortex and associated areas. There was also no significant change in cognitive function as measured by P300 response.

BACKGROUND & OBJECTIVES: Induction to high altitude (HA) leads to deterioration in cognitive functions. The event related potentials (ERPs) like P300 are reported to be affected by hypoxia and bring about impairments in cognitive performance. The aim of the study was to investigate the effect of hypobaric hypoxia on event related potentials at two different altitudes i.e., 3200 m (HA I) and 4300 m (HA II) in ascending order to see how ERPs change with increasing altitude. METHODS: The study was carried out on 20 healthy male volunteers at sea level (SL) and thereafter at high altitude (HA) in Eastern Himalayas and on return to sea level (RSL). The P300 was recorded by using standard auditory odd ball paradigm with compact -4 (Nicolet, USA). RESULTS: The N1, N2 and P2 latencies were not significantly affected at HA I and HA II in comparison with SL indicating no effect of hypobaric hypoxia on sensory conduction. However, at HA II, most of the subjects showed an increase in latency of P3 component reflecting sensory discrimination and delay in evaluation process at 4300 m. At HA I, only 10 out of 20 subjects showed an increase in P3 wave latency and 3 did not show any change in N2-P3 components. INTERPRETATION & CONCLUSION: The results of the present study showed an increase in P300 wave latency at 3200 and 4300 m of high altitude. The observations suggest that hypoxia causes slowing of the signal processing at 4300 m, and magnitudes of the effects are altitude dependent with higher level of decline observed with increasing altitude.

The effect of hypobaric hypoxia on Brain Stem Auditory evoked potentials (BAERs) were studied. BAERs were recorded in 30 volunteers at sea level (SL) and then at high altitude (HA) of 3200 m (HA I) and 4300 m (HA II) in Eastern Himalayas and on return to sea level (RSL). The BAERs were recorded using Nicolet Compact - 4 (USA) in response to monaural auditory stimuli consisting of clicks of 100 ps square pulse at a rate of 15/sec. The BAERs were recorded on day 4 of their stay at 3200 m and 4300 m respectively. Findings indicated an increase in absolute peak latencies of wave V at 3200 m, which was statistically significant. On further ascent to 4300 m there was an increase in absolute peak latencies of wave I and III indicating delay in sensory conduction at the medullo-pontine auditory pathways.

Acidophilic bacteria inhabiting acidic mine regions cause natural leaching of sulphidic ores. They are now exploited in industrial operations for leaching of metals and beneficiation of low-grade and recalcitrant ores. Recent trends emphasize application of thermoacidophiles and genetic engineering of ore-leaching bacteria for greater success in this area. This requires an in-depth understanding on the molecular genetics of these bacteria and construction of cloning vectors for them. Metal resistance is considered as the most suitable phenotypic trait for cloning vectors of bio-mining chemolithoautotrophic (viz. Acidithiobacillus ferrooxidans) and heterotrophic (Acidiphilium and Acidocella species) bacteria of mine environments. These bacteria take part in ore-leaching either directly or indirectly, exhibit low to high level of resistance/tolerance to various metals under different conditions. Majority of these bacteria contain one or more plasmids--the genetic elements that usually carry metal resistant genes. But none of the At. ferrooxidans plasmids has been definitely proved to harbour metal-resistant genes which have mostly been found in the chromosome of this bacterium. Plasmids of acidophilic heterotrophs of the genera Acidiphilium and Acidocella, on the other hand, carry metal resistant genes. While genes bestowing arsenic resistance in Acidiphilium multivorum are similar to those analyzed from other sources, the metal (Cd and Zn)-resistance conferring cloned plasmid DNA fragments from Acidiphilium symbioticum KM2 and Acidocella GS19h strains were found to have no sequence similarity with the reported Cd- and Zn-resistant genes. Such observations indicate some novel aspects of metal resistance in acidophilic bacteria.

Anti Orthostatic Hypokinetic posture in rats by tail suspension for 15 days (d) simulates the deconditioning effects of weightlessness on the weight bearing bones. The present study evaluates the effects of daily 4 hour (h) weight support (WS) during simulated weightlessness (S-W) in preventing these changes. Adult male albino rats were divided into three groups as (i) Control (CON, n = 12), (ii) Hind limb unweighing by tail suspension for 15 d (HU, n = 18), (iii) HU with daily 4 h WS (4 HRWS, n = 11). After 15 d tibia from all the animals were removed and subsequently dried, ashed and then calcium content of the bones were determined. HU showed reductions in the water content by 35.8%, organic matrix by 12.2% and calcium content by 33.4% of tibia. 4 h WS during S-W resulted in complete prevention of water loss and organic matrix loss and partial prevention of the loss of calcium content. Calcium content of tibia in 4 HRWS remained 15.2% less as compared to CON. These findings indicate that 4 h WS is partially successful in preventing the demineralisation effects of S-W on weight bearing bone tibia.

Human work performances decreases at high altitude (HA). This decrement does not appear to be similar for every individual, may be due to variety of factors like elevation, mode of induction, work intensity, physical condition and specificity of the subjects. The purpose of the study was to evaluate the effects of alteration in responses of oxygen saturation (SaO2) and oxygen consumption (VO2) to a standard exercise in women mountaineering trainees under hypobaric hypoxia. Experiments were conducted in 2 groups (10 each) of females and compared the difference in responses of native women of moderate altitude with those of the plains/low altitude. A standard exercise test (Modified Harvard Step-Test for women) was performed on a 30 cm stool with 24 cycles/min for 5 min, initially at 2100 m and then at 4350 m. The exercise VO2 values for plains dwelling women achieved apparently VO2max level at both altitude locations with significant reduction in SaO2 during standard exercise. Exercise VO2 values decreased on exposure to 4350 m with further reduction in SaO2. Whereas with same work intensity, under same situation the exercise VO2 values of the moderate altitude women did not appear to have reached VO2max. They also maintained comparatively higher level of SaO2. It may be concluded that hypoxic exposure along with mountaineering training, the moderate altitude women maintained a higher level of SaO2 during standard exercise at both altitude locations, compared to low altitude women who might have lost a compensatory reserve to defend the hypoxic stress to exercise. Thus, moderate altitude women are proved to be better fit for hypoxic tolerance/HA performance.

BACKGROUND & OBJECTIVES: Frostbite, the severest form of cold injury is a serious medical problem for our Armed Forces operating in the snow bound areas at high altitude. Effects of treatment by rapid rewarming in tea decoction followed by combined therapy of pentoxifylline, aspirin and vitamin C were evaluated in amelioration of tissue damage due to experimentally induced frostbite in rats. METHODS: Experiments were conducted in 2 groups (25 each) of albino rats (control i.e., untreated and experimental i.e., treated). Frostbite was produced experimentally in all the animals by exposing one of the hind limbs at -12 +/- 1 degree C with wind flow 25-30 lit/min for 30 min in a freezing-machine, with simultaneous recordings of rectal and ambient temperatures. The degree of tissue damage was assessed after 10 days. Following cold exposure, neither external thawing nor any medication was given to the animals of the control group; while the exposed limb of the experimental animals was rewarmed in tea decoction maintained at 37-39 degrees C for 30 min immediately after cold exposure, with simultaneous oral ingestion of warm tea decoction. These animals were also given pentoxifylline (40 mg/kg), aspirin (5 mg/kg) and vitamin C (50 mg/kg) twice daily orally for the next 7 days. RESULTS: In the control group, 68 per cent animals suffered from severe (56%) to very severe (12%) frostbite, while the remaining 32 per cent had moderate frostbite. No animals of this group could escape injury or suffered anything less than moderate frostbite; whereas 52 per cent of experimental animals escaped injury (no frostbite) and 32 and 16 per cent suffered only with primary and moderate degree of injury, respectively. None from this group suffered from severe or very severe frostbite. INTERPRETATION & CONCLUSION: It is evident from the study that this combined therapy resulted in significant improvement in the degree of tissue preservation and proved to be highly beneficial as an immediate treatment of frostbite in rats. The combined pharmacological properties of these drugs might have altered the haemorrheologic status of blood and produced curative beneficial effect in improving tissue survival. Clinical studies are required for confirmation of these beneficial effects in humans, which has already been taken up.

Sleep and sleep deprivation are intimately related to performance. Sleep management of people working in different sectors of the society like multi shift workers, nurses, doctors, students in professional schools and the armed forces has a great bearing on performance, health and safety of the subject population. The detrimental effects of sleep deprivation on psychological performance are indicated as increased lapsing, cognitive slowing, memory impairment, decrease in vigilance and sustained attention and shift in optimum response capability. Its effects on physical performance are manifested as decline in ability to perform maximal exercise, self-selected walking pace and increase in perceived exertion. Sleep deprivation appears to have no effect in respect of muscle contractile properties and maximum anaerobic power. At high altitude (HA), there is a reduction in NREM sleep with frequent awakening due to hypoxia as a physiological adaptive measure to prevent accentuation of hypoxemia due to sleep-hypoventilation. Total sleep deprivation for 48 hours at high altitude can affect the acclimatization status, thermoregulation efficiency and cognitive functions. The concept of 'sleepiness' has also been studied, as it is an emerging concept for better understanding of the effects of sleep deprivation and its effects on performance. A special mention of sustained operations in the armed forces has been made keeping in mind its uniqueness in challenging the normal sleep-work schedule and its deployment in extreme environment and operational condition. This article reviews in detail the functions of sleep, its requirement and the effects of sleep deprivation on human performance.

Leprosy bacillus (LB) and leprosy derived in vitro culture forms, the chemoautotrophic nocardioform (CAN) bacteria, showed an extremely close homology and identity with each other as regards a chemoautotrophic nutritional pattern, a nocardioform morphology, a weak acid-fastness coupled with Gram and Gomori's stain positivity, an exclusive mycolate and lipid profile, a phenolic glycolipid (PGL-I) and a highly sequestrated DNA characteristic, namely, a unique small size, a low G+C % mole, an exceptionally high gamma and UV radiation resistance, and a high thermal resistance. LB/CAN bacteria (CANb) gave positive signals for 36 kDa protein PCR, as well as, for 65 kDa epitope, and hybridisation with two or more probes and also by RFLP-analysis. Both LB/and CAN bacteria exhibited bacillary multiplication in the mouse footpads (MFP), nerve infiltration and evidences for local pathogenicity associated with pronounced systemic invasion. A highly reproducible mutilation model could be established which enabled a successful application of the postulates of Koch. The proof of their total identity was their anergic reactions in LL cases counterpoised against Mitsuda type strong nodular responses, mirroring the reactions of leprosy bacilli in TT cases, in accordance with the dictum of XIth International Leprosy Congress (1978). Thus, the chemoautotrophic nutritional requirements of LB, entirely unsuspected for a medically important pathogenic bacterium, having dimorphic (both bacillary and mycelial) characters with spores, mycelia and granules and unique pathogenicity of multilation manifested through the virulence factor, the enzyme collagenase, made LB or M leprae the highly enigmatic bacterium for so long.

OBJECTIVES AND METHOD: Forty patients (mean age 45 years; 24 men) attending a tertiary care hospital in eastern India during the period 1996-2000 were investigated to evaluate the etiology and clinical spectrum of obscure gastrointestinal bleed. RESULTS: The patients presented to hospital after mean symptom duration of 2.5 years. They had received an average of 15 units of blood transfusion. Most patients presented with recurrent melena (85%); all had iron-deficiency anemia. A total of 230 investigations (89 gastroscopies, 54 colonoscopies, 25 double-contrast meal and follow-through studies, 14 small bowel enemas, 24 radionuclide scans, 16 mesenteric angiographies and 8 intraoperative endoscopies) yielded positive diagnosis in 87.5% of cases. The diseases encountered were small bowel and colonic angiodysplasias (32.5%), ileal Crohn's disease (20%), intestinal tuberculosis (10%), intestinal tumors (10%), nonspecific small bowel ulcers and strictures (7.5%), Meckel's diverticulum (5%) and hemobilia (2.5%). The etiology remained obscure in 5 (12.5%) cases. Overall success of surgery was 63%; in-hospital mortality was 7.5%. CONCLUSION: Though obscure gastrointestinal bleed is commonly caused by angiodysplasias, it can be an atypical presentation of Crohn's disease.

BACKGROUND: Topical glyceryl trinitrate (GTN) may produce healing of anal fissure by decreasing the high resting anal sphincter pressure in these patients. The present study assessed the efficacy of GTN in chronic anal fissure in a double-blind placebo-controlled trial. METHOD: Patients with chronic anal fissure (for more than 8 weeks) underwent measurement of maximum anal resting pressure (MARP) before and 12 minutes after application of either 0.2% GTN or placebo ointment in a randomized manner. They then received twice-daily local application of their respective ointment for 6 weeks. Symptoms and healing of fissure were assessed; patients were evaluated at 3 months for evidence of relapse. RESULTS: 19 adult patients (12 men) were studied; 10 received GTN and 9 placebo. Mean (SD) MARP decreased from 131.0 (32.3) cm H2O to 93.5 (28.4) cm H2O (p<0.05) with GTN and from 150.5 (36.9) cm H2O to 142.8 (35.0) cm H2O (p=ns) with placebo. Fissure healed in 7 of 10 patients treated with GTN and 2 of 9 patients treated with placebo (p<0.05). There was no relapse of fissure in either group. CONCLUSION: Local application of GTN was effective in healing chronic anal fissure.

Till date only three series of immunoproliferative small intestinal disease (IPSID) describing 22 patients have been reported from India. Seven patients with IPSID in two tertiary referral centers in India are included in the study. Diagnosis was based on typical clinical features [diarrhoea (7/7), weight loss (7/7), clubbing (6/7), fever (3/7), abdominal pain and lump (3/7)], biochemical evidence of malabsorption and duodenal biopsy findings. All patients were young males (mean age 29.8 +/- 11.8 years, range 17-53). Atypical features included gastric involvement (1/7), colonic involvement (1/7) and appearance of pigmented nails following anti-cancer chemotherapy (1/7) which disappeared six months after omitting doxorubin from chemotherapy regimen. Parasitic infestation was common. Ascaris lumbricoides (1/7), Giardia lamblia and hookworm (1/7), Strongyloides stercoralis and Trichuris trichura (1/7). In the latter patient S. stercoralis became disseminated after anti-malignant chemotherapy. One patient had gastric H. pylori infection. Four of the seven patients who were misdiagnosed as tropical sprue were treated with tetracycline. This raises doubt on efficacy of tetracycline alone in treatment of IPSID. One other patient was misdiagnosed and treated as intestinal tuberculosis. Early diagnosis and administration of chemotherapy may improve survival in this disease.
